September 18, 2016: Our Most Proximate Neighbor Has A Family

Scientists have reported the discovery of a planet slightly larger than Earth orbiting in the habitable zone of the red dwarf Proxima Centauri, a little over 4.24 light years from the Sun.



Phil Plait goes into some detail on his blog, Bad Astronomy, about why this is a Really Big Discovery, right in our galactic back yard. He also points out that we won't be taking a holiday trip there any time soon.
